About the Program

The Bachelor in Italian is a degree program for students who want to develop their language skills and explore Italian culture, literature, and society. It's a great way to gain a deeper understanding of the Italian language and its significance in the world.

The curriculum includes language courses that focus on developing proficiency in Italian, as well as cultural and literary studies that explore Italian history, art, cinema, and literature. You'll also have the chance to participate in study abroad opportunities and develop your language skills in an immersive environment.

Graduates of this program can pursue careers as translators, interpreters, language instructors, or cultural consultants. They may work in fields such as education, tourism, international business, or journalism, and may find employment with companies like the Italian Embassy, the Canadian Broadcasting Corporation, or language schools in Italy.
